convertible top problems...

I have a 1991 RX7 Convertible and I am having trouple with the electric top. Does anyone know if I can turn it off and just put it up manually?

yes u can i had a 91 convertible and decided to make it a t2
but when time came to drop the top i forgot about that it wasnt that much of a pain electrically i just wanted to be manual.its easy just unscrew the 2 bolts on each side of the solenoids.
